Abstract:
Stimulated emission was obtained from Ho3+ ions (5I7→5I8 transition) in a new single-component self-activated system with aluminum holmium garnet crystals grown by the Czochralski method. The thresholds of the λ= 2.129 and 2.122 laser emission at 90 °K were 9 and 14 J/cm, respectively. The absorption and luminescence spectra were used in the derivation of the Stark splitting scheme of the 5I7 and 5I8 terms. The lifetime of the 5I7 term was determined (τ ≈ 10 msec).
